Expand Map
DVD Sales & Service in Cloverdale, IN
1. Redbox
1033 N Main St, Cloverdale, IN 46120
OPEN NOW:8:00 am - 9:00 pm
2. Family Video
820 Indianapolis Rd, Greencastle, IN 46135
OPEN NOW:11:00 am - 10:00 pm
Showing 1-2 of 2
1033 N Main St, Cloverdale, IN 46120
820 Indianapolis Rd, Greencastle, IN 46135
Showing 1-2 of 2